Quick Summary
The Indian Health Service (IHS), Navajo Area, Crownpoint Service Unit has issued a Request for Quotations (RFQ) for Office Chairs and Tables for the Crownpoint Healthcare Facility in Crownpoint, NM. This acquisition is set aside for Indian Small Business Economic Enterprises (ISBEE). Quotes are due by March 5, 2026, at 8:00 AM MST.
Scope of Work
The solicitation (No. 75H71026Q00088) seeks new office furniture and accessories to replace worn items and address infection control issues. Key requirements include:
- Chairs: 22 Executive High Back Bonded Leather Chairs (Charcoal grey), 4 Big & Tall Executive Chairs (Brown vinyl), 16 Bonded Leather High Back Chairs (Black), and 10 Stack Chairs with Arms (Navy blue).
- Tables: 32 Flip Top Tables (72x34) in various finishes (Sterling ash, carbon mesh, mahogany).
- Accessories: 32 Power/Data Ports (black plastic and metal). Vendors must provide make, model, colors, warranty information, and shipping details with tracking numbers. All items must be delivered at one time, with no back stock.

Submission & Evaluation
Quotes are due by March 5, 2026, at 8:00 AM MST. Offers will be evaluated based on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A). Offerors must have an active registration in the System for Award Management (SAM) at the time of submission and award.
Eligibility / Set-Aside
This acquisition is an Indian Small Business Economic Enterprise (ISBEE) Set-Aside. Bidders must complete and submit the "Indian Health Service Buy Indian Act Indian Economic Enterprise Representation Form" to self-certify their eligibility as an Indian Economic Enterprise (IEE) with Indian Ownership. This eligibility must be maintained throughout the solicitation, award, and contract performance periods.
